Professional Mattress Cleaning Service

A good night’s sleep is crucial for your overall health and well-being, and a clean mattress plays a vital role in achieving it.

WonderKlean’s professional mattress cleaning service helps to deep clean your mattress, eliminating dirt, dust mites and other allergens that can disrupt your sleep and cause health issues.

Our CUCKOO+ Service Team uses industry-approved equipment to deep clean your mattress, removing all factors that cause health issues and disrupt your sleep. Not only does our mattress cleaning service improve the overall hygiene of your mattress, but it also helps to prolong the lifespan of your mattress, saving you money in the long run.

Don’t let a dirty mattress affect your quality of sleep—contact WonderKlean today to schedule your mattress cleaning service and enjoy a restful night’s sleep every night.

Triple Supreme Deep Cleaning

Restores a clean mattress without contaminants and bugs


  • Professional-standard vacuuming equipment with twice the suction power.
  • Removes allergen-causing particles, dust, and micro debris.


  • Deep cleaning using our H2O Storm Cleaning method.


  • Matrix Grid Method accurately detects all microbes.
  • Effectively killing bed bugs and dust mites.

7 Thorough Steps Secure Your Sleep Quality

Why You Should Clean Your Mattress Now

For Health Reasons

A regular cleaning twice a year is necessary to keep your mattress clean and free from dust mites, bed bug, fungi or any other microbes.

For A Longer Mattress Lifespan

When sweat, children urine, and menses leaks are unavoidable, cleaning your mattress is essential if you want it to last for a years.

For A Smarter Spending and Budgeting

A quality mattress is expensive, and regularly changing it can be costly.

If you don’t clean the mattress now, you might face critical health issues:

  • Sinus
  • Eczema
  • Conjunctivitis
  • Asthma
  • Respiratory inflammation
  • Severe Coughing

If you don’t clean the mattress the professional way, these problems will arise:

  • Unpleasant Odour
  • Significant Stains
  • Foam Erosion
  • Bed Settlement/Indents
  • Mold Formation


General Questions

No. Our service personnel will only clean your mattress, pillow(s), and bedframe.

No. We will conduct hydro cleaning on top of the mattress only

No. We will not move/remove your mattress.

No. We will conduct dry-cleaning to clean your pillow(s) but not the bolster.

No. To clean the pillow(s), we will apply the dry-cleaning method only.

Yes. We highly recommend that you change the bed sheet/protector after the service as your mattress has just been freshly cleaned.

Each cleaning service takes averagely 90 minutes to complete but the service duration may vary depending on the mattress size. After the service, you will need to wait for approximately 4 hours for the mattress to dry completely before use.

No. Our cleaning service doesn’t apply to a full coconut fibre mattress.

No. Our service personnel will only clean your mattress, pillow(s), and bedframe.

No. Customers are required to wait for 4 hours before the mattress is thoroughly dried and ready to use.

No unpleasant odour will remain on your mattress. Instead, there will be a mild floral scent.

It takes 4 hours to let your mattress fully dry after cleaning.